4,000 miles · Aug 2, 2013
Engine And Engine CoolingPower Train

NOISE COMING FROM TRANSMISSION: VERY LOAD CLUNK WHEN RELEASING THE CLUTCH LEVER IN GEAR, ALSO CLUNK AT ANY SPEED WHEN LETTING OFF THE THROTTLE AND CLUNKS AGAIN WHEN YOU ACCELERATE. ALSO GREAT DEAL OF BACKLASH IN ANY GEAR AND GETTING WORST. INDICATING POSSIBLE TRANSMISSION FAILURE.

TL* THE CONTACT OWNS A 2010 KAWASAKI VN1700-C. WHILE DRIVING APPROXIMATELY 20 MPH AT NIGHT THE CONTACT NOTICED THE LIGHTS ON THE INSTRUMENT PANEL REFLECTED A GLARE ONTO THE WINDSHIELD AND OBSTRUCTED HIS VISIBILITY. THE VEHICLE WAS TAKEN TO THE DEALER FOR DIAGNOSTIC TESTING. THE TECHNICIAN RECOMMENDED ADDING A CHROME VISOR TO THE INSTRUMENT PANEL. THE FAILURE CONTINUED AFTER THE VISOR WAS REPLACED. THE VEHICLE WAS NOT REPAIRED. THE APPROXIMATE FAILURE MILEAGE WAS 300.
